Pennant International Group Full Year 2023 Earnings: UK£0.025 loss per share (vs UK£0.025 loss in FY 2022)

In This Article:

Pennant International Group (LON:PEN) Full Year 2023 Results

Key Financial Results

  • Revenue: UK£15.5m (up 14% from FY 2022).

  • Net loss: UK£933.0k (loss widened by 3.6% from FY 2022).

  • UK£0.025 loss per share (in line with FY 2022).

Pennant International Group Earnings Insights

The primary driver behind last 12 months revenue was the Uk & Europe segment contributing a total revenue of UK£8.82m (57% of total revenue). Notably, cost of sales worth UK£7.81m amounted to 50% of total revenue thereby underscoring the impact on earnings. The largest operating expense was General & Administrative costs, amounting to UK£7.88m (91% of total expenses). Explore how PEN's revenue and expenses shape its earnings.

Looking ahead, revenue is forecast to stay flat during the next 2 years compared to a 8.5% growth forecast for the Aerospace & Defense industry in the United Kingdom.
